Footymad preview History of the Cardiff City v Middlesbrough fixture

Cardiff City prepare to entertain Middlesbrough at Cardiff City Stadium on Saturday afternoon, with high hopes of improving on their excellent record against the opposition, having chalked up an impressive 17 wins out of 26 previous matches.

The most recent encounter between these two sides at Cardiff City Stadium was less than a year ago, in December 2011, with Middlesbrough inflicting a narrow 2-3 defeat upon the Bluebirds in a Championship match.

Recent respective form guides

Cardiff City could not have a more impressive recent home form, having won each of the last six games. In this time, Bluebirds have rattled up an impressive 15 goals, and conceded 4.

Middlesbrough's away form is equally impressive, remaining unbeaten in their last six, winning five and drawing the one. Those games have seen the Boro pummel 11 goals, and let in 3.

Cardiff City are just outside the promotion places, in 3rd, having taken 31 points from 16 games.

Middlesbrough are holding the final promotion place in the npower Championship, and have accumulated 32 points from the 16 games they have played so far.
